Jac Volbeda

Graduated in 1982 having been awarded the 's-Hertogenbosch City prize for his objects, paintings, an architectural design plan and an extended essay about Land-art.

In the years since graduation Jac focused fully on his painting activities, resulting in commissions by private buyers, businesses and public sector organisations.

His paintings have been sold to many countries in Europe, America and Australia.

He moved in 2003 to the island of Baleshare, where he continued his work as an artist.

In 2006 Jac started B&B Bagh Alluin where he also exhibited his work. In 2022 he decided to retire from running his B&B.

Again and again he finds inspiration for his artwork in his immediate environment and more distant remote landscapes in Scotland.

The ever-changing landscapes and colours create evocative, expressive paintings.

The inspiration that landscapes provide him with is transferred to the canvas in a robust and expressive style. The overpowering impact of the rugged Scottish scenery as well as the intriguing Spanish landscapes are portrayed in wild vigorous gestures. However, if you examine the evocativeness of the paintings more closely, you will discover a multiplicity of shades of colour and subtle outlines.

Jac exhibited in a large number of galleries and art libraries in Holland and Great Britain and several galleries in the Netherlands have work in stock.
